Manufactured by Cummins Inc. - Cummins Emission Solutionsbased in USA
Selective catalytic reduction (SCR) systems use a chemical reductant, in this case urea, which converts to ammonia in the exhaust stream and reacts with NOx over a catalyst to form harmless nitrogen gas and water. Urea is a benign substance that is generally made from natural gas and widely used in industry and agriculture. In our SCR ...

Manufactured by Dinex A/Sbased in DENMARK
The primary function of SCR catalyst in a diesel ATS is to convert harmful nitrogen oxides (NOx = NO + NO2) in the exhaust gas to nitrogen and water. The SCR reaction takes place on the catalyst, in the presence of NH3 generated from AdBlue (Urea and water solution) upfront the SCR catalyst. Advanced emissions regulations like EU VI /EPA/China N6/Bharat 6 need above 95% NOx conversion levels and ...
